If you’d like to obtain a fixer-upper or renovate your present house, right here are four great choices to give consideration to:
1. Credit or cash card
I understand, credit and cash cards appear to be opposites. But also for our intents and purposes, you’d usage money or credit cards in comparable circumstances. These are funding options only when the renovations you’ll want to make are low-dollar jobs.
You can certainly do numerous value-adding house renovation tasks for a comparatively tiny amount of cash. As an example, artwork is just a way that is cheap update the appearance of your house. Or you might lay a brand new flooring in a small restroom to modernize it. These improvements might cost a few thousand bucks.
In this example, it most likely does not add up to undergo the lengthy second mortgage or process that is refinancing. Alternatively, you can either cut back money in advance or make use of 0% basic APR bank card to fund your renovation in advance.
Should you choose choose to use a charge card, however, you should be very sure that you’ll pay it back before starting paying out interest.
Money and bank card aren’t actually the most useful financing options for the renovation, particularly if you’re preparation a few thousand bucks well well well worth of renovations in your house.
